Missouri Headwaters State Park Campground Montana

Missouri Headwaters State Park Overview

Missouri Headwaters State Park 016

Missouri Headwaters State Park campground has 17 single-family campsites and is located close to the Madison River and where Lewis & Clark pitched a tent back in the day. There is also on teepee site available to rent. Campsites can accommodate tents, trailers and RVs. Each site also has a table, fire ring and grate.

Campground amenities include drinking water and flush & vault toilets. There’s also a picnic area, mixed-use trails, interpretive exhibits/displays and a ranger station. Cell service is good.

Missouri Headwaters State Park – Area Recreation

The area is rich with history, including the location of Lewis & Clark camped in 1805. The park encompasses the confluence of the Jefferson, Madison and Gallatin Rivers. It offers great boating, canoeing, kayaking and fishing. Other outdoor activities include biking, hiking, horseback riding, picnicking, swimming, and wildlife viewing.

One Comment on “Missouri Headwaters State Park”

  1. Very clean, well maintained, and this year’s camp host is a great guy. Very little (almost NO) shade. Wasps. Some sites share a parking pad so you are REALLY close to the next campers. Full/busy, but people have been out and about all day so it’s quiet at night.
